Angelina Jolie says she has receipts.
According to new court documents that were filed under seal on March 12, the Maleficent 2 star claims she’s prepared to offer “proof and authority” against ex Brad Pitt in her claim of domestic violence during their upcoming divorce trial. It was that same day, Angie also filed another document under seal regarding testimony of their minor children: Pax, 17, Zahara, 16, Shiloh, 14, and twins, Knox and Vivienne, 12.
